Market position

This G3SG1 sits firmly at the budget end of its family and behaves like a thin-market commodity rather than a collectible. Demand is light and sporadic; most listings see little action unless the piece is unusually clean or carries strong sticker work, so sellers need realistic expectations about turn time.

How the wear ladder is priced

The ladder is stepped with a capped top and a clear split between the clean end and the rest, creating a visible gap rather than a smooth slide. Expect the curve to drop off after the top band, then level out across the mid and lower bands where copies cluster.

Buy vs sell spread

Listings often show an optimistic ask while the actual cashout a seller nets sits lower because the market is thin and buyers shy. That gap widens when the record is worn or the stickers don't appeal; costs like fees and quick-sale demand further widen the apparent spread.

The clean-end premium

The very best wear commands most of the interest and trades at multiples above the common copies; collectors chasing the minimal wear tolerate the thin market and pay up. Clean G3SG1 | Red Jasper are the only ones that reliably pull a notable premium relative to the rest.

Capped float range

This hydrographic finish does not reach extreme wear, so the worst copies read cleaner than typical weapons with full float spread. The floor cluster sits higher and behaves more like a mid-wear band than a true worst wear, muting the low-end bargain effect.

No seed lottery

There is no pattern to chase here; pattern and seed variation are irrelevant so float is the decisive attribute. That keeps pricing simple: wear and sticker appeal move price, pattern noise does not.
